My grandfather, John M. Cargill, had done extensive research on this line and has passed
on to me lots of documentation about the Cargill line. In a manuscript "And The Tree
Grew" written by my grandfather's cousin, Millie Wolf in 1979, is written the
information about Julia. Derostus and Deleilah, my ggg-grandparents, would have been aunt
and uncle to Julia.
Derostus and his second wife Martha Patricia White had a daughter, Cicily, is written to
have the given name Julia Ann but she was born 1849. Perhaps she was named after your
gggg-grandmother.
I would be glad to send you a picture of some of the Cargill side. Derostus and Patricia
did migrate to Milam Co., Tx in the 1850's.
My gg-grandfather, Alfred Cargill son of Derostus, fought in the Civil War in Erath Co.,
Tx and his son, John cargill, married Jennie Bell Head from Erath Co. I beleive many of
the Cargills moved to that area.
